March 9, 1952 – January 10, 2026
Thresa Sue Martin, 73, of Reliance, departed this life peacefully on January 10, 2026, at her residence.
She was born on March 9, 1952, in Archville, to the late Rev. Frank and Louise Green Jones. A lover of life, she was a simple lady, that adored her family. She was a member of Fairview Baptist Church. She managed Hiwassee Outfitters and enjoyed the numerous people she met on the Hiwassee River. An avid reader and a tremendous grandmother, she will be deeply missed by all who knew her. One of her fondest memories included supporting TRUMP.
In addition to her parents, Rev. Frank and Louise Green Jones, she was preceded in death by her beloved husband, Charlie A. Martin; one son, Charles L. Martin; one daughter, Tammy Sue Martin.
